I was reading this Determine your eligibility-Canadian Experience Class link, and a part of the requirement is :
"You must have at least 12 months of full-time, or an equal amount in part-time, skilled work experience. Full-time work means at least 30 hours of paid work per week."
From the above statement, 12 months (i.e. 52 weeks) at 30 hrs/week would be a total of 1560 hrs in 12 months
Suppose I was living and working full time in Canada for 10.5 months (i.e. 42 weeks) at 56 hrs/week (i.e. a total of 2352 hrs) would be able to claim that I (more than) did the equivalent of a 12 months full-time work in Canada and as such I would be eligible to apply for PR under Canadian Experience Class?
